Workers who establish health problems like kidney cancer due to their profession may be entitled to compensation through legal settlements. The Environment Protection Agency (EPA) and the Federal Employers Liability Act (FELA) play critical functions in this context.
Secret Points of FELA
FELA Overview: FELA is a federal law that enables railroad workers to sue their employers for workplace injuries or health problems triggered by neglect. Unlike normal employees' compensation systems, workers can recover damages for discomfort, suffering, and lost salaries.

Carelessness Requirement: To win a FELA claim, an employee should prove that their employer's neglect caused their kidney cancer. This might involve showing exposure to toxic compounds and inadequate safety procedures.

Kinds of Damages: Claims can consist of medical expenses, lost income, and payment for discomfort and suffering.

Is there a time frame for submitting a claim?
Yes, FELA declares usually need to be submitted within three years of the injury or medical diagnosis to be considered legitimate.
